About Manuel Gomes

Manuel Gomes is a scholar working on Economics and Econometrics, Statistics and Probability, General Health Professions, Neurology and Epidemiology, having authored 72 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(27 papers), Advanced Causal Inference Techniques (12 papers), Economic and Environmental Valuation (7 papers), Statistical Methods and Bayesian Inference (6 papers), Healthcare Policy and Management (4 papers), Statistical Methods and Inference (4 papers), Healthcare cost, quality, practices (3 papers) and Delphi Technique in Research (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Statistics and Probability (133 citations), Economics and Econometrics (322 citations), Health Informatics (14 citations), Geriatrics and Gerontology (31 citations) and Neurology (130 citations). Manuel Gomes has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Switzerland and United States. Frequent co-authors include Rita Faria, Ian R. White, David Epstein, Richard Grieve, James R. Carpenter, Richard M. Nixon, Simon G. Thompson, Edmond S. W. Ng, Elizabeth Murray and James Raftery. Their work appears in journals such as PharmacoEconomics, Health Economics, Value in Health, Statistics in Medicine and Medical Decision Making.
